Double Bunk Beds Top and Bottom Bunk beds can add storage functionality and style to a room for kids Many of these sets convert into separate beds permitting them to grow with the kids and remain a practical sleeping option One important thing to be aware of is that bunk beds require a high ceiling You must make sure that there is enough headroom to safely get into and out of the bed Size Double bunk beds that are top and bottom are available in different sizes so its important to determine the space available in your room before you purchase You should also consider how tall your ceilings are because the size of your bunk bed will impact its safety and comfort level If your ceilings have a high height you may want to consider a lofted twin bed that can be divided into two separate beds This will allow you to free up space in your bedroom and give each child their own bedroom that is theirs to use for sleepovers and other parties Some lofted bed styles include builtin drawers for extra storage which is particularly useful if you only have a limited area to work from The type of ladder or staircase that is used to construct the bunk bed is another important aspect to think about Some standard bunk bed designs utilize straight staircases some have an angled or a staircase with handrails Both are safe and easy for children to climb but the style you pick will depend on the amount of floor space available in your room Straight ladders require less space whereas stairs offer more safety features like handrails and builtin storage The size of the mattress on the top bunk must be a consideration It is important that the mattress in the top bunk isnt too thick This can cause the sleeper to fall and get injured Most bunk bed manufacturers recommend that you choose a fullsize or twinsize mattress on the top bunk and twinsize or twin XL mattresses for the bottom bunk When you are choosing a bunkbed you should also take into account the age of your children Kids under six years old shouldnt be sleeping on the top bunk because they could easily slip off and harm themselves Set firm guidelines for your children and make sure they follow them You should also teach your children to use the ladder safely and not hang anything on the guardrails of the top bunk This includes scarves or belts They could pose an injury to children who strangle so you should be clear that the top bunk is not a playground You can also install a clip light right near the ladder which will help your children find their way back down the stairs after dark Style There are many style options for bunk beds Some have a traditional design and others offer a rustic relaxed look Some furniture styles offer a clean direct style that is the right place in the modern bedroom No matter what style you choose be sure to keep safety always a top priority Place the bunk beds in such a way that your children wont bump against each other when going into or out of bed Check that compact bunk beds are placed far enough from lights ceiling fans and heaters blind cords which can strangle your child and windows Bunk beds come in different styles and colors Some have a beautiful natural wood grain while others have a paint job that can range from neutral stone to a bold navy The wood finish can influence the overall look of the bed Therefore its crucial to think about the color scheme in your childs bedroom when you choose the bunk bed If youre looking to ensure that your childrens bunk bed grows with them select a model which can be separated into two twin beds once they are ready to transition to the teens The Harper Bright model Harper Bright comes in a variety of stunning painted finishes as well as a rich walnut Many parents opt for a double bed with stairs as it lets their children easily move from and into the top mattress without worrying about falling off the ladder If you have children who arent yet ready take the stairs there are plenty of alternatives to choose from For instance this twin over queen bunk bed from Harper Bright can accommodate three mattresses and offers a pullout trundle with a convenient trundle design that can accommodate one mattress in the space of one rail Whatever style you pick be sure your children understand that the top bunk should only be used for sleeping Its a good idea remind them of this principle often especially when your friends come over and you may be tempted to play on the top bunk You should also reinforce the safety rules for your children when they are hosting a sleepover Safety While bunk beds can be exciting and fun however there are certain safety issues that need to be considered It is crucial to check your bunk bed on a regular basis for loose or missing pieces and follow the instructions provided by the manufacturer It is also important to ensure that the frame of your bunk bed is strong enough and secure especially when you are using the top sleeping space Children shouldnt be permitted to play on the top bunk and they must learn that only one person is allowed to sleep there at any one time It can be difficult to enforce this policy but its in their safety Another important safety precaution is to make sure that the mattress on the top bunk fits correctly The mattress on the top bunk must not be any deeper than 15cm and must fit comfortably into the rails of the guard A deeper mattress could cause the side guards to move away from the wall which could lead to falling from the bunk bed Similarly the mattress on the bottom of the bunk should be supported by slats or wires that are directly underneath and are secured securely at both ends If a mattress is only held up by the bed frame or slats it may slide down to the bottom bunk causing injuries to the child Lastly it is important to have a ladder that allows your child to climb into the top bunk safely Many manufacturers make angled more stable ladders than the traditional vertical ones These are perfect for younger children You should also consider installing a nightlight to help your child locate the ladder in the dark More than half of bunk bed injuries occur in children who are less than six years old old Children who are not old enough to sleep on top bunks could be injured from falling during naptime or when playing The majority of falls are preventable by taking simple safety precautions Its also a good idea to install guardrails on the sides of the upper bunk and a fitted sheet that covers the entire top bunk Mattress Bunk beds can be ideal for roommates and families who are limited in storage or living space By stacking two or three beds on top of each other they allow for comfortable sleeping for up to three people in one room These fun spaceefficient frames can be used to accommodate twin or full mattresses and can be combined with storage options such as drawers and trundles which can maximize the available sleeping space It is crucial to gauge the size and thickness of your mattress before buying a bunk bed The higher the thickness of your bunk bed the more space you will have between the sleepers head and the ceiling You should also choose a mattress that is at the right height for the top bunk so that you can use the railings to get into and out of bed safely If you choose a thicker mattress for the top bunk its a good idea to also choose a trundle mattress that is thinner that fits in the lower frame so there will be more headroom between the upper and lower beds This will reduce the risk of hitting the head while reading a book or getting ready for bed It will also make it easier to switch between bedding and mattresses There are a variety of mattresses you can consider for your bunk bed such as hybrid innerspring memory foam and latex Memory foam mattresses are a fantastic option for the top bunk as they contour to your body and eliminate pressure It is also lighter than other types mattresses for bunk beds This will help to lessen the chance of overheating on hot nights If youre looking for a longlasting and affordable option a mattress made of coils could be the best option They are constructed of metal springs that create a sturdy base for the bunk Theyre generally cheaper than other kinds These mattresses are ideal for teens and older children who may need more support to sit up in bed to study or playing games
